Idle Thoughts of an Idle Fellow, published in 1886, is a collection of humorous essays by Jerome K. … A second Idle Thoughts book, The Second Thoughts of An Idle Fellow, was published in 1898. The essays had previously appeared in Home Chimes, the same magazine that later serialised Jerome’s Three Men in a Boat. (Wikipedia.org)

CONTENTS

On the Art of Making Up One’s Mind

On the Disadvantage of Not Getting What One Wants

On the Exceptional Merit attaching to the Things We Meant To Do

On the Preparation and Employment of Love Philtres

On the Delights and Benefits of Slavery

On the Care and Management of Women

On the Minding of Other People’s Business

On the Time Wasted in Looking Before One Leaps

On the Nobility of Ourselves

On the Motherliness of Man

On the Inadvisability of Following Advice

On the Playing of Marches at the Funerals Of Marionettes
